At a glance

Sensei AI is positioned as a real-time interview copilot offered mainly through a web-based workflow, with a large interview-advice blog.

Pricing snapshot: Sensei AI lists subscription pricing; verify current pricing and terms on its checkout page before buying.

Feature ExtraBrain Sensei AI Note
Core workflow Live interview and meeting copilot with local-first session context. Web-based real-time interview copilot with a large advice blog. Choose based on whether you need a general desktop copilot or a more specialized interview product.
Pricing model Free core Mac app; Pro is $9.99/month ($6.99 Founder), $79/year, or $149 Lifetime; external AI or transcription costs depend on providers you choose. Sensei AI lists subscription pricing; verify current pricing and terms on its checkout page before buying. Verify live checkout pages before purchase because plans and promotions can change.
Provider model Local Gemma 4 where installed and compatible plus BYO OpenAI, Anthropic, Claude, Codex, or compatible endpoints. Sensei AI bundles or manages AI access through its own product plans unless its current checkout says otherwise. Provider control matters when billing, retention, and model choice need to stay in your accounts.
Responsible use Publishes policy reminders for interviews, meetings, schools, employers, and platforms. Sensei AI users should also verify the rules for each interview or meeting. No tool can make prohibited assistance acceptable.
